Danes Bottom

Early-attested site in the Parish of Rollright

Etymology

Danes Bottom (6″). Cf. Debedene c. 1180 Jeffery, Deanhulle c. 1300 Jeffery, Dean quarr '1630 Jeffery, Deans quarry , Deans Bottom 1713 Jeffery. The original name is 'deep valley,' v. dēop , denu . Only the second element has survived.
